The main conflict in 'Angels Before Man' revolves around the celestial rebellion led by Lucifer against divine authority. The story delves into the philosophical and emotional turmoil of angels torn between loyalty and rebellion. Lucifer’s defiance isn’t just about power—it’s a clash of ideals, questioning the nature of free will and obedience. The tension escalates as factions form, with some angels embracing change while others cling to tradition.

The conflict isn’t purely physical; it’s a battle of ideologies. Lucifer’s charisma draws followers, but his methods sow discord, forcing others to confront their beliefs. The narrative explores themes of betrayal, identity, and the cost of defiance. The fallout of the rebellion reshapes heaven, leaving scars that echo through eternity. It’s a timeless struggle between order and chaos, framed in celestial grandeur.

What is the main conflict in 'Angelfall' between angels and humans?

5 Jawaban2025-06-23 22:33:08
In 'Angelfall', the conflict between angels and humans is brutal and existential. The angels, led by the ruthless Uriel, launch a devastating attack on humanity, viewing humans as inferior and unworthy of sharing the world. Cities are destroyed, societies collapse, and survivors are left scrambling in the aftermath. The angels' goal isn't just domination—it's eradication, with some factions even experimenting on humans in twisted attempts to 'purify' or repurpose them. The humans aren't helpless, though. Resistance groups form, but the struggle is uneven. The protagonist, Penryn, embodies this fight, navigating a world where trust is scarce and survival means facing both angelic wrath and human desperation. The conflict escalates when she allies with Raffe, a fallen angel with his own vendetta, blurring the line between enemy and ally. This isn't just a war of strength; it's a clash of ideologies, where humanity's resilience is pitted against celestial coldness.

How does 'Angels Before Man' explore angel mythology?

5 Jawaban2025-06-30 17:14:18
'Angels Before Man' dives deep into angel mythology by reimagining celestial beings with raw, human-like flaws and conflicts. The story strips away the typical halo-and-harp imagery, portraying angels as complex entities wrestling with power struggles, jealousy, and existential dread. Their hierarchy isn’t just divine order—it’s a political battleground where archangels scheme and lower-ranked angels rebel. The novel’s twist lies in its focus on fallen angels, framing their descent as a tragic yet inevitable result of free will clashing with rigid celestial dogma. What sets it apart is how it blends biblical references with fresh lore. Seraphim aren’t just fiery guardians; their wings burn with literal holy fire that can purify or consume. Cherubim, often depicted as childlike, are instead terrifying amalgamations of eyes and wings, policing heaven’s secrets. The protagonist’s journey mirrors Lucifer’s fall but adds layers—washed-out memories of creation, fractured loyalties, and the haunting question of whether rebellion was destiny or choice. The mythology feels expansive, grounding cosmic themes in intimate character arcs.
